Kirk Reuille hands off the RAW Racing Yamaha FZR400 to Kevin Rentzell during a WERA National Endurance race at Roebling Road in March of 1990. If you raced the Heavyweight or Mediumweight classes in WERA Endurance during the 1990 season RAW Racing was one team you did not want to see. Reuille, Rentzell and Alan Bertagnoli could make riders on 750cc and even 1000cc bikes look bad. If I recall correctly RAW even made the overall podium at least once during this season.
